Good Morning! I’m John Branning, Lead Pastor of Central United Methodist

Church. Tomorrow we celebrate the birth of our Nation. As a Chaplain in the

Mississippi Army National Guard, I am well aware of the cost that many

have paid so that we can say that we live in the land of the free.

From the founding of this Nation, the principle of Sacrifice would be more

than an idea to ponder; instead, it would be a way of life for the citizens of

this Country. In every generation men and women have defended this belief

in freedom. The Christian faith is surrounded by the image of freedom also.

Not only did Jesus teach us to sacrifice for one another, but through his death

and resurrection, he set us free from the bondage of sin and death. This

freedom that comes from Christ allows us to love one another and that when

this life ends, a new one begins.
